Types of Genetic Transfer Between Organisms02:18

Types of Genetic Transfer Between Organisms

30.6K
Genetic transfer occurs when genetic information is passed from one organism to another. It occurs via two mechanisms: vertical gene transfer and horizontal gene transfer. Vertical gene transfer occurs when genetic information is transferred from one generation to the next, which happens much more frequently than horizontal gene transfer. Both sexual and asexual reproduction are forms of vertical gene transfer, where one or more organisms pass some or all of their genome onto their progeny.

The Respiratory System01:16

The Respiratory System

89.1K
The respiratory system is comprised of the organs that enable breathing. Air enters the nostrils and mouth, followed by the pharynx (throat) and larynx (voice box), which lead to the trachea (windpipe). In the thoracic cavity, the trachea splits into two bronchi that allow air to enter the lungs. The bronchi split into progressively smaller bronchioles and terminate in small groups of tiny sacs in the lungs called alveoli, where gas exchange occurs.

背景情况:

  • 人类类流感病毒3 (HPIV3) 和呼吸道同胞病毒 (RSV) 是幼儿下呼吸道感染的主要原因.
  • 目前治疗HPIV3和RSV感染的疗效有限,并且没有疫苗可用.
  • 病毒的进入依赖于融合糖蛋白 (F),它经历了结构变化以调解膜融合.

研究的目的:

  • 开发针对HPIV3和RSV的融合糖蛋白的新型抗病毒药物.
  • 研究来自HPIV3融合蛋白的C终端七度重复 (HRC) 域的脂的抑制潜力.

主要方法:

  • 基于HPIV3 F蛋白的HRC域的脂的设计和合成.
  • 在体外测试以评估脂对HPIV3和RSV的抗病毒活性.
  • 生物物理方法,包括共结晶,以确定抑制剂与病毒F蛋白的结合相互作用.

主要成果:

  • 来自HPIV3 F HRC域的脂强烈抑制HPIV3和RSV的感染.
  • 在抑制RSV感染方面,脂的疗效与RSV HRC衍生相美.
  • 抑制剂与HPIV3和RSV F蛋白质的N终端七度重复 (HRN) 域具有很高的亲和力.
  • 共同晶体结构显示了HRN域内抑制剂的独特结合方式.

结论:

  • 针对病毒融合糖蛋白的HRN域的脂代表了开发广泛抗病毒疗法的有希望的策略.
  • 这些发现为病毒融合抑制的结构机制提供了新的见解.
  • 开发的脂可以作为针对HPIV3和RSV感染的新疗法的化合物.
